Event description

What is the buzz about STEM? This webinar will provide you with an insight into the origins of STEM and how it has been translated and applied in the Australian Early Childhood context.

Learning Outcomes:

- Learn about the history and origins of STEM (Science, Maths, Technology and Engineering) and why there is a focus on it

- Formulate ways to identify STEM in your existing program materials, interactions environments and pace.

- Discuss and brainstorm the language of STEM

- Compare and apply use of a variety of documentation methods to enable STEM to be visible

- Re-think and reflect on how STEM is applied in your curriculum

Quality Areas:

QA 1 Educational program and practice

Duration: 1 hour 15 min

Training Presenter: Rebecca Thompson -Stone & Sprocket
